Importance of Learning Data Science

Data science is a perfect blend of algorithms, tools, and machine learning principles to find different hidden patterns from the raw data. It encompasses the exploratory analysis from it and uses various machine learning algorithms to accurately predict the future.

A data scientist perceives data from different angles to ensure they know the data’s ins and outs; some are not known earlier. All the ideas in science-fiction movies of Hollywood can turn into reality by data science.

Lately, data science has become a tool to make a prediction about the future, making use of predictive casual analytics, machine learning, and prescriptive analytics (Predictive and decision science).

Data science is related to big data, machine learning, and data mining. It applies knowledge and actionable insights from data across a broad range of application domains.

What Is Data Science?

Data science is also known as a concept to unify data analytics, statistics, informatics, and their related methods to analyze and understand actual phenomena with data. It uses tools, techniques, and theories taken from several fields such as statistics, mathematics, information science, domain knowledge, and computer science.

Why Learn Data Science?

Data science has been hailed as one of the most exciting jobs of the 21st century. Here are some of the reasons that make data science important and highly paid professionals.

A Fuel of the 21st Century:

In the 21st century, the industry is driving through a force called Data. Several industries, including automobile industries, are using data to improve their business. Data science is also called the electricity that powers the industries today.

They need data to improve their productivity, make their business grow, and offer the best products to their customers. Data scientists make valuable sense of data with their tools in order to make profound decisions. They also use high-performing computing to solve complex data problems.

Huge Demand And less Supply:

There is a huge abundance of data, but there are no proper resources to convert this data into useful products. There is a lack of skilled professionals who help companies utilize the potential that data holds.

We can say that there is a lack of data literacy in the market in order to fill this gap in supply. So it’s worth learning data science in its high-demanding time.

A Lucrative Career:

According to Glassdoor, a data scientist can earn more than the national average salary, where the average salary for a Data Scientist is $117,345/yr, and the national average salary is $44,456 yearly. So this makes data science a highly lucrative career choice.

The absence of data scientists is resulting in a double increase in income. So learning data science is beneficial, and a data scientist can enjoy the position of prestige in the company.

Remote Working

Exploring A Full-Time Remote Working Opportunity: Here Is How To Prepare

The COVID-19 Pandemic resulted in the creation of a new working order that was only being used earlier in a sparing fashion. Remote working or working from home was models that were earlier employed by employees who could not make it to their offices because of some other reason. As the pandemic resulted in the closure of physical workspaces because of governmentally mandated protocols, businesses rushed towards adopting remote working models and started hiring remote workers. This allowed businesses to stay afloat, run their operations, pay employees and carry on with economic sustenance. In this article, we are going to look at a comprehensive guide on jobs remote. We are going to discover some of its benefits of it and prescribe how employees who are looking for full-time remote working opportunities should prepare themselves. Remote Working: Meaning and Definition Remote working/teleworking/working from home is the process of an employee working for an organization, not within the confines of office space. In this working arrangement, an employee can work from anywhere for a business. Remote working means that employees do not have to travel to their place of work. It means that employees are no longer bound to come to office space, showroom, or warehouse to do actual company work. Remote working necessitates the use of technology, digital platforms, and software to enable employees to connect with their managers, bosses, and colleagues. Major Benefits of Ful-Time Remote Working Opportunities Many studies conducted over the last few months have shown that remote working comes with its own sets of advantages for both employees as well as employers. In this section, we will try to shed some light on both. Benefits For Employers- Data shows that remote working has allowed employees to become 13% more efficient and productive in terms of work output and task completion rates. Businesses who opt for remote working can save a lot of additional overhead costs that are part and parcel of an office setup. It has given businesses the ability to attract the best talents from any part of the world. This has opened up an exciting new prospect, which was earlier not possible. Studies have also shown that remote working has allowed for the creation of a fitter and leaner workforce with fewer employees taking sick or casual leaves. Finally, employers have smartly been able to add to the working hours as employees have on average been saving close to 5 hours on traveling to and from the office. Benefits For Employees- The remote working model has allowed employees to spend more time with their family members and carry on a healthy mix of work-life balance. It has allowed for lesser travel stress, especially in developed countries of the world where traffic issues can lead to tensions and exhaustion. The rise of the Digital Nomad means an employee that is enjoying his stay in a location of their choice while working full-time with an organization. Remote working has also allowed employees to add to their savings. Whether it is the fuel or train costs, or additional money spent on lunches, everything is getting saved. Lastly, employees are able to put in their best productivity and performance and win a good chance of getting higher increments, bonuses, and promotions. 5 Easy Steps to Help you Prepare for a Full-Time Remote Working Opportunity In this section, we are going to look at 5 easy steps that can help professionals prepare for a full-time remote working opportunity- 1. Supervisor Vs Manager

Supervisor Vs Manager: Similarities & Differences Between Them – 2021 Updated

The success of the firm depends on the employees and the ones to whom they are accountable, i.e., Managers and Supervisors. These are the two most important positions in an organization, but there are some differences between the two roles (Supervisor Vs Manager) and this we will discuss in this article. One of the most important tools that a leader can use is leadership communication and these leaders can add some layers to your company’s structure.  Besides, when writing a job description, confusion arises about whether to hire a manager or a supervisor. So, now let’s proceed to know the key differences and similarities between them. Supervisors And Their Job Responsibilities - All You Need To Know A Supervisor is a leader who makes the decisions after it is approved or confirmed by the manager. In a company, if any issue or problem arises related to the employees or customers, then supervisors are the initial point of contact for the same.  If the issue is serious and deserves high attention, then the supervisor presents it to the manager. Besides, the primary duty of a supervisor is to have a constant eye on the employees and analyze their performance & productivity in the workplace. The job responsibilities of a supervisor are described below. Have a look! Train new employees  Analyze the productivity and performance of the employees Collecting and submitting performance reports to the department manager Maintaining and keeping track of personnel records and employee’s schedule Addressing inquiries and complaints from customers Training employees by giving them regular feedbacks Assisting employees in knowing their job responsibilities  Creating deadlines and goals that match with the company’s plan. Managers And Their Job Responsibilities - All You Need To Know A manager is an individual in a high-level administrative who manages the resources of the organization and makes all the important decisions that affect all areas of business operations. They plan the desired amount that should be spent on resources, and they allocate the same to each department to reach their business objectives. Managers have the decision-making capabilities, and they manage the department as a whole. Some of the primary responsibilities of a manager are described below. Have a look! Communicating department information to employees through team meetings or one-on-one. Provides work schedules to employees Assigning tasks to employees and gives feedback to the employees constantly Evaluating employee performance and set goals for employees  Organizing training and professional development opportunities for all employees Collaborating with the human resources department  Organizing the firm’s management structure to streamline performance, communication, and workflow.  Supervisor Vs Manager - Differences Between Them The key differences between managers and supervisors are their level of authority, salary, responsibilities, and objectives. Generally, managers are higher-level and higher-level leaders in an organization. They are responsible for team management, goal setting, and strategic planning. On the other hand, supervisors are closer to the day-to-day tasks of their teams, and they ensure that the manager’s goal (or company’s objectives) are achieved. Now, let’s get to know in detail. 1. Salary  Those individuals who are in the managerial post have a higher salary than the supervisor. Keep in mind; managers have more duties or burdens than supervisors (If you compare Supervisor Vs Manager) because they manage the company as a whole, which is why their salary is high.  2. Objectives If you compare Supervisor Vs Manager, they both have different goals to meet. Supervisors coordinate with employees (have internal focus) and make sure that their work has been completed on time or not. Whereas managers have an external focus, they manage and represent the company as a whole. They make powerful plans and make sure it gives a good ROI.  3. Responsibilities Supervisors enhance the productivity of the employees and position their departments for success. They understand the duties of the employees in detail, and they report the same to the managers about their performance and productivity. Whereas managers meet with supervisors to understand the structure of the employees and their responsibilities. Managers oversee the budget and attend meetings for the same. 4. Level Of Authority There is no doubt that managers are the higher-ranking employees within the organization. A company can have many supervisors, and managers can promote the employee to become a supervisor. On the other hand, the level of authority of a supervisor is generally low as compared to managers.  Supervisor Vs Manager - Similarities Between Them The job role of a manager and a supervisor can differ, but the responsibilities that they carry out are almost the same.
